The flywheel of a steam engine begins to rotate from rest with a constant angular acceleration of 1.25 rad/s2. It accelerates for 26.7 s, then maintains a constant angular velocity. Calculate the total angle through which the wheel has turned 49.9 s after it begins rotating.
